Output 24b1e32f48608d41b34a5988a8c83b368d48e1d575766f3375ca697df4ff6d20:0

value
761095712
script pubkey
OP_0 OP_PUSHBYTES_20 707ed8a95ebcec835e529f8392dbf93eab643aa5
address
bc1qwpld3227hnkgxhjjn7pe9kle864kgw49tp8n4z
transaction
24b1e32f48608d41b34a5988a8c83b368d48e1d575766f3375ca697df4ff6d20
confirmations
358953
spent
true